ARM硬件调试与JX44B0教学系统解析

需积分: 9 3 下载量 121 浏览量 更新于2024-08-17 收藏 2MB PPT 举报
"JXB系列教学系统的硬件组成-ARM硬件调试方法" 本文主要探讨了JX44B0系列教学系统的硬件组成以及ARM硬件调试方法,其中涵盖了嵌入式系统体系结构设计的重要概念。ARM(Advanced RISC Machines)是一种广泛使用的微处理器架构,以其高效能和低功耗特性在众多领域占据主导地位。ARM公司不直接生产芯片,而是通过授权其设计给其他半导体制造商,以适应不同应用场景的需求。 嵌入式系统通常由微处理器(如ARM)、存储器(如SDRAM和ROM)、输入输出设备(I/O)、模数转换器(A/D)、数模转换器(D/A)、人机交互界面和各种接口(如串口、并口、USB、以太网)等组成。在JX44B0教学系统中,具体采用了S3C44B0X作为核心处理器,它是一个基于ARM技术的微处理器,适合于教育和科研环境。 在硬件设计过程中,印刷电路板(PCB)的设计是关键环节,它决定了系统的电气性能和可靠性。此外,选择合适的硬件组件,如处理器、内存和外设接口,对于满足系统需求和优化性能至关重要。在硬件调试阶段,开发者需要检查电路连接、电源稳定性、信号完整性等问题,确保所有组件能协同工作。 嵌入式系统的开发遵循一系列步骤,首先是系统需求分析,明确系统功能和非功能需求,如性能、成本和功耗。接着进行体系结构设计,定义硬件和软件的功能划分,并选择合适的软硬件平台。硬件/软件协同设计阶段,开发者并行设计软件和硬件,以便快速推进项目。系统集成阶段,将所有组件组合在一起,进行调试以解决可能出现的问题。最后,通过系统测试验证设计是否符合最初设定的规格要求。 JX44B0教学系统以武汉创维特公司的产品为例,展示了如何将这些理论应用于实际教学环境中,帮助学生理解和掌握嵌入式系统的实际操作和调试技巧。通过这样的实践,学生能够深入理解ARM硬件的工作原理,提升其在嵌入式系统开发领域的技能。
2022-10-05 上传